Zhenguo Ma has authored 32 papers that have received a total of 597 indexed citations.
This includes 16 papers in Astronomy and Astrophysics, 7 papers in Atomic and Molecular Physics, and Optics and 6 papers in Renewable Energy, Sustainability and the Environment. The topics of these papers are Ionosphere and magnetosphere dynamics (11 papers), Solar and Space Plasma Dynamics (8 papers) and CO2 Reduction Techniques and Catalysts (6 papers). Zhenguo Ma is often cited by papers focused on Ionosphere and magnetosphere dynamics (11 papers), Solar and Space Plasma Dynamics (8 papers) and CO2 Reduction Techniques and Catalysts (6 papers) and collaborates with scholars based in China, Canada and United States. Zhenguo Ma's co-authors include Hongqiang Li, Nan Xiao, Jieshan Qiu and Jinpeng Bai and has published in prestigious journals such as Journal of Geophysical Research Atmospheres, ACS Nano and Carbon.
